Unicorn in business software, Salesforce is buying workplace messaging app Slack for $27.7 billion to takeover Microsoft.
“This is a match made in heaven. Together, Salesforce and Slack will shape the future of enterprise software and transform the way everyone works in the all-digital, work-from-anywhere world,” Salesforce co-founder and CEO Marc Benioff said.
Meanwhile, in July, Slack filed a complaint in the European Union accusing Microsoft of illegally bundling Teams into Office 365 in a way that blocks its removal by customers who may prefer Slack.
Slack has transformed from a fast-rising startup formed as a gaming company in 2009. While it has now been a major competitor of Microsoft.
Slowly, Slack grew into a full productivity suite with video meeting features, file hosting, IT administration, and all manner of other features typically offered by large enterprise corporations.
The deal announced Tuesday is by far the largest in the 21-year history of Salesforce.
